Xilinx ISE入门教程:安装与工程设计流程详解

需积分: 9 2 下载量 37 浏览量 更新于2024-07-31 收藏 2.63MB DOCX 举报
Xilinx ISE是一款由Xilinx公司提供的针对FPGA/CPLD(Field-Programmable Gate Array/Complex Programmable Logic Device)设计和开发的集成开发环境(IDE)。本文档提供了Xilinx ISE 5.2i版本的安装教程和基本工程设计流程,对初学者极具指导价值。 首先,安装Xilinx ISE 5.2i前需确保系统的配置满足高性能要求,因为综合、仿真和实现过程涉及大量计算。对于Spartan II和XC9500/XL/XV系列的FPGA,推荐内存和虚拟内存至少为128MB,而Virtex-II XC2V8000系列则需3GB以上的内存。安装过程分为几个步骤: 1. **系统配置要求**:强调了对CPU主频、主板速度、硬盘速度以及内存容量的高要求,尤其是内存,以优化综合、仿真和实现速度。 2. **安装步骤**: - 启动Windows XP,插入安装光盘并执行Install.exe,进入安装界面。 - 输入有效的Registration ID,选择安装路径,然后选择要使用的器件模型。 - 再次选择器件种类,根据需求继续进行安装。 - 安装完成后,需在环境变量中设置Xilinx路径,例如将`变量名`设为`Xilinx`,`变量值`设为安装目录。 3. **安装第三方软件**:建议安装第三方软件如ModelSim进行仿真,这在工程设计中必不可少。 4. **工程设计流程**: - Xilinx ISE的开发流程包括五个关键步骤:设计输入(Design Entry),通过输入设计描述语言描述电路;综合(Synthesis),将硬件描述转换为逻辑门级网表;实现(Implementation),进行逻辑布局和布线;验证(Verification),通过仿真和测试确保设计功能正确性;最后是下载(Download),将设计下载到目标硬件进行实际应用。 通过这篇指南,读者可以了解到如何安装和配置Xilinx ISE,并熟悉其在FPGA/CPLD设计中的基本工作流程,这对于初学者理解和掌握这一工具非常有帮助。每个阶段都需要相应的工具和技术支持,如使用VHDL或Verilog进行设计输入,使用综合器进行逻辑优化,使用模拟器进行功能验证,以及使用下载工具将设计部署到实际硬件。